Transaction 3d6a4296cb195396b9ba5445ee6958c44924601e16d260fadada588384520cfe
1 Input
1 Output
-
3d6a4296cb195396b9ba5445ee6958c44924601e16d260fadada588384520cfe:0
- value
- 1831110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 602f2646e2002c147b5ec8b78bbf750c98f3f539 OP_EQUAL
- address
- 3ATbGxxApHtWqVKSdDfpumvGNKv14t8qZd